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$1,884 in Valencia versus $1,486 in Leon.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$2,714 in Valencia versus $2,099 in Leon.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$3,545 in Valencia versus $2,711 in Leon.

Living in Valencia is roughly 27% more expensive than Leon, driven mainly by Clothing & Footwear.

Both cities are pricier than the global median: Valencia 40% above, Leon 11% above.
